How to Use Data Analytics for E-commerce Optimization?

In today’s digital age, data analytics has become a crucial tool for e-commerce businesses looking to optimize their operations and drive growth. By harnessing the power of data, online retailers can gain valuable insights into customer behavior, preferences, and trends, allowing them to make informed decisions that can enhance the overall shopping experience and increase sales. In this article, we will explore how e-commerce businesses can leverage data analytics to improve their operations and achieve greater success.

Understanding Customer Behavior

One of the key benefits of using data analytics in e-commerce is gaining a deep understanding of customer behavior. By analyzing data such as website traffic, click-through rates, and purchase history, businesses can identify patterns and trends that reveal valuable insights into what customers are looking for and how they prefer to shop. This information can then be used to optimize the online shopping experience, from personalized product recommendations to targeted marketing campaigns that resonate with individual customers.

Improving Inventory Management

Effective inventory management is essential for e-commerce businesses to ensure that they have the right products in stock at the right time. Data analytics can help businesses forecast demand, track inventory levels, and identify slow-moving items that may need to be discounted or removed from the shelves. By leveraging data analytics tools, e-commerce businesses can optimize their inventory management practices, reduce stockouts, and improve overall efficiency.

Enhancing Marketing Strategies

Data analytics can also be a game-changer when it comes to marketing strategies for e-commerce businesses. By analyzing customer data and purchasing behavior, businesses can create targeted marketing campaigns that are more likely to resonate with their target audience. Whether it’s through personalized email campaigns, social media ads, or targeted promotions, data analytics can help e-commerce businesses reach the right customers with the right message at the right time, ultimately driving more sales and increasing customer loyalty.

Optimizing Pricing Strategies

Pricing plays a critical role in the success of any e-commerce business. Data analytics can help businesses analyze market trends, competitor pricing, and customer willingness to pay, enabling them to optimize their pricing strategies for maximum profitability. By leveraging data analytics tools to monitor pricing trends in real-time, e-commerce businesses can make data-driven decisions that help them stay competitive in a constantly evolving market.

Streamlining the Checkout Process

The checkout process is a crucial touchpoint in the customer journey, and data analytics can help e-commerce businesses streamline this process to reduce cart abandonment rates and increase conversions. By analyzing data on checkout page performance, businesses can identify potential bottlenecks, such as complex forms or payment processing issues, and make adjustments to improve the overall user experience. This can lead to higher conversion rates, increased customer satisfaction, and ultimately, more sales.
